| Index: webkit/browser/fileapi/sandbox_mount_point_provider.cc
|
| diff --git a/webkit/browser/fileapi/sandbox_mount_point_provider.cc b/webkit/browser/fileapi/sandbox_mount_point_provider.cc
|
| index 49cbfe842fa2f68a276e8e7f6f0c02f6545387a8..b9789fb098169dba1879a2ae64a378971db3e8b4 100644
|
| --- a/webkit/browser/fileapi/sandbox_mount_point_provider.cc
|
| +++ b/webkit/browser/fileapi/sandbox_mount_point_provider.cc
|
| @@ -171,7 +171,8 @@ SandboxMountPointProvider::SandboxMountPointProvider(
|
| AccessObserverList::Source access_observers_src;
|
|
|
| if (enable_usage_tracking_) {
|
| - update_observers_src.AddObserver(quota_observer_.get(), file_task_runner_);
|
| + update_observers_src.AddObserver(quota_observer_.get(),
|
| + file_task_runner_.get());
|
| access_observers_src.AddObserver(quota_observer_.get(), NULL);
|
| }
|
|
|
| @@ -317,7 +318,7 @@ FileSystemOperation* SandboxMountPointProvider::CreateFileSystemOperation(
|
| operation_context->set_update_observers(update_observers_);
|
| operation_context->set_access_observers(access_observers_);
|
|
|
| - if (special_storage_policy_ &&
|
| + if (special_storage_policy_.get() &&
|
| special_storage_policy_->IsStorageUnlimited(url.origin())) {
|
| operation_context->set_quota_limit_type(quota::kQuotaLimitTypeUnlimited);
|
| } else {
|
|
|